TURN-208: Gatevale turnstile counters at the Merrow Field pilot double-count when a rotation reverses mid-cycle. Attendance totals drift roughly 2% high per event. The debounce window fix is implemented, reviewed by Ilsa, and soak-tested across two simulated match days without drift. Ready for your cut; the candidate build is identified below.

trace token, tagag-tafog: htk6_5ed18c

**Quarterly Planning Note — Joint Venture Proposal**

For the finance team: Calderstone Analytics has proposed a joint venture to commercialize the Ferrowind modelling suite in the Austevale market. We have reviewed their capital commitment terms, governance split, and exit provisions in detail. Initial diligence suggests acceptable risk, pending audit of their receivables. Strategic context follows below.

internal memo for fahif-bawip: Headcount on the Ralael team goes from 48 to 96 by the end of December. Gross margin on Ralael came in at 14 percent against a plan of 3 percent.

Ticket VLD-218: staging env for the Sievebox validator plugin system is misconfigured. `PLUGIN_DIR` points at the old checkout path, so no third-party validators load and CI passes vacuously. Fix: update the path, re-run the plugin smoke suite, confirm the schema-check plugin registers. Also the plugin registry credentials were never set in staging. The registry access secret belongs on the next line.

sealed setting: VAULT_KEY20=69e2a0b23f1a79fbf692